summaryrefslogtreecommitdiff
path: root/tests
diff options
context:
space:
mode:
authorChristian Struck <christian@struck.se>2013-01-31 15:50:09 +0100
committerChristian Struck <christian@struck.se>2013-01-31 15:50:09 +0100
commit59929df267e4480a9f7c123c4e22c28b49e78758 (patch)
treecbdd5555b61a0e3e3edc6dfc31d0db9828a22ddc /tests
parent6a71307e5affd7653db04d9943c77cccf30c3886 (diff)
downloadbvg-grabber-59929df267e4480a9f7c123c4e22c28b49e78758.tar.gz
bvg-grabber-59929df267e4480a9f7c123c4e22c28b49e78758.tar.bz2
bvg-grabber-59929df267e4480a9f7c123c4e22c28b49e78758.zip
Added test for the new dateformat
Diffstat (limited to 'tests')
-rw-r--r--tests/test_format.py18
1 files changed, 9 insertions, 9 deletions
diff --git a/tests/test_format.py b/tests/test_format.py
index 9c3e35e..8e7827e 100644
--- a/tests/test_format.py
+++ b/tests/test_format.py
@@ -2,8 +2,7 @@
import datetime
import unittest
-from bvggrabber.api import fullformat, hourformat
-from bvggrabber.utils.format import int2bin
+from bvggrabber.utils.format import int2bin, fullformat, dateformat, timeformat
class TestFormats(unittest.TestCase):
@@ -21,11 +20,12 @@ class TestFormats(unittest.TestCase):
def test_datetime_formats(self):
f = [(datetime.datetime(2013, 1, 2, 3, 4, 0),
- "2013-01-02 03:04:00", "03:04"),
- (datetime.datetime(2013, 1, 2),
- "2013-01-02 00:00:00", "00:00"),
- (datetime.datetime(2013, 1, 2, 3, 4, 30),
- "2013-01-02 03:04:30", "03:04")]
- for dt, sf, sh in f:
+ "2013-01-02 03:04:00", "03:04", "02.01.2013"),
+ (datetime.datetime(2013, 5, 2),
+ "2013-05-02 00:00:00", "00:00", "02.05.2013"),
+ (datetime.datetime(2013, 2, 2, 3, 4, 30),
+ "2013-02-02 03:04:30", "03:04", "02.02.2013")]
+ for dt, sf, st, sd in f:
self.assertEqual(fullformat(dt), sf)
- self.assertEqual(hourformat(dt), sh)
+ self.assertEqual(dateformat(dt), sd)
+ self.assertEqual(timeformat(dt), st)